An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Swim Well Manager to join our enthusiastic and friendly team at move Urmston. In this role, you will be responsible for managing and developing our Swim Well program. We currently have over 1800 children learning to swim and we are looking for someone with significant experience who can continue to maintain the success of the program and to unleash any further potential. In this role you will be responsible for:-

  • Delivering inspirational management to your team in the delivery of the swim well brand at your centre.
  • To spend time with your swimming teachers to support and guide the team, to bring out their potential.
  • To manage our School swimming program.
  • To provide feedback and to make recommendations on new initiatives and ideas to improve the operational running of the program/generate growth.

    Flexibility to cover lessons and work different days and times as the business requires.
  • Swim England Level 1 & 2 Qualification or equivalent or someone who has a passion for sport and is willing to undertake this training.
  • Experience of managing and developing a large swimming program
  • The ideal candidate will embody the Trafford Leisure Values of Making a Difference, being Open and Honest, Valuing Diversity and bringing Energy & Empathy into all ways of working.

Trafford Leisure is a community interest company, we exist to benefit the Trafford community and we are committed to being a responsible and sustainable employer. We are the largest operator of sport and leisure facilities in Trafford, operating eight indoor facilities, one golf course and driving range and 31 outdoor football pitches, attracting over 2 million visits per year and employing a workforce of over 300 people.
